Why Weight Matters in Waterproofing
Every gram trusts a multi-day backpacking trip. Typical waterproof equipment-- thick rubber ponchos, hefty coated nylon coverings-- provided strong protection yet came at a penalizing weight cost. The difficulty has actually always been stabilizing 3 contending needs: waterproofness, breathability, and weight. Heavy products can attain two of these conveniently; the real advancement lies in accomplishing all 3 at the same time. Today's products are doing exactly that, and backpackers are reaping the benefits.
Secret Lightweight Waterproof Products
Gore-Tex and ePTFE Membranes
Gore-Tex remains the gold requirement by which most water-proof breathable fabrics are determined. It makes use of an expanded polytetrafluoroethylene (ePTFE) membrane bound to a face textile. The membrane layer has billions of tiny pores-- big enough to let water vapor (sweat) escape, but much as well small for fluid water beads to go into. Modern Gore-Tex Pro and Gore-Tex Paclite variations have come to be significantly lighter while keeping their epic sturdiness and waterproofing. Paclite, particularly, eliminates the internal backer material, cutting significant weight for those prioritizing minimalism on route.
Dyneema Composite Fabric (DCF)
Previously referred to as Cuben Fiber, Dyneema Composite Textile has become something of a cult product amongst ultralight backpackers. Initially established for high-performance sailing, DCF is a laminate made from ultra-high-molecular-weight polyethylene fibers sandwiched in between two slim polyester movies. The outcome is a material that is astonishingly strong for its weight, naturally waterproof (not simply water-resistant), and highly tear-resistant. Tarps, rainfall jackets, and knapsacks made from DCF can consider a fraction of their traditional equivalents. The compromise is cost-- DCF equipment is considerably more costly-- and a characteristic crinkly feeling that some hikers locate less comfortable versus the skin.
eVent and Various other ePTFE Alternatives
eVent is a significant competitor to Gore-Tex that makes use of a similar ePTFE membrane layer however with a key distinction: the pores are not coated with polyurethane, which indicates moisture vapor can get away directly with the membrane layer without needing sweat stress to push it out. In practice, this makes occasion jackets feel extra breathable during high-output tasks like steep climbs up. For backpackers that push hard on path and run cozy, this can be a significant benefit in a similarly lightweight plan.
Silnylon and Silpoly
Silicone-impregnated nylon (silnylon) and silicone-impregnated polyester (silpoly) are workhorses of the ultralight shelter world. These products are coated on both sides with silicone, producing a very water-resistant fabric that stays adaptable even in chilly temperature levels. Silpoly has grown in appeal due to the fact click here for more info that polyester stretches less than nylon when wet, which suggests silpoly tarps and camping tent bodies preserve their pitch much better in rain. Neither silnylon nor silpoly is completely water-proof under prolonged hydrostatic pressure, but also for rainfall flys and shelters with proper pitch and catenary contours, they execute exceptionally well at an extremely reduced weight and rate factor.
Durable Water Repellent (DWR) Coatings
Many water-proof textiles rely on a DWR finish put on the external face textile to cause water to bead and roll off rather than saturate the product. Without an operating DWR, also a Gore-Tex coat can "wet out," causing the face material to soak up water and significantly lower breathability. DWR wears away gradually with cleaning and abrasion. Backpackers need to rejuvenate their gear's DWR periodically using spray-on or wash-in treatments. The market is actively moving far from PFAS-based DWR chemicals towards fluorine-free options that are more secure for the setting without dramatically compromising performance.
Choosing the Right Material for Your Trip
The best waterproof material depends upon your concerns. For multi-week expeditions in severe conditions, the sturdiness of Gore-Tex Pro validates the additional weight. For a fast-and-light weekend break trip, a silpoly tarp or DCF rain jacket might be perfect. Budget also plays a role-- silnylon shelters offer remarkable performance per buck, while DCF continues to be a costs financial investment.
Comprehending what's within your equipment helps you make smarter selections on the path-- and keeps you drier when the climate turns.
